  <description>We were listening to Lewis Howes interview Rich Roll, a man who transformed his life from being an alcoholic and drug addict to one of the fittest men in the world.&amp;amp;nbsp; Lewis was asking Rich about how to achieve your big dreams.&amp;amp;nbsp; Rather than just giving the stereotypical answer like “you have to go for it, be bold, take massive action,” Rich gave a much more practical answer that Eva thought was super helpful and wanted to share with all the Big Dreamers.&amp;amp;nbsp; Specifically, Rich shared that when you push outside of your comfort zone, the best strategy is to just push a tad bit outside.&amp;amp;nbsp; Start with an action today that doesn’t involve a lot of risk.&amp;amp;nbsp; You need to get outside of the comfort zone because that is where growth happens, but you can start small, build your confidence, and then take an additional step.&amp;amp;nbsp; Eva applies Rich’s lesson to her own experience as a podcaster, and how her growth these past 5 years has come from many little steps outside of her comfort zone rather than one huge one.&amp;amp;nbsp; Thank you Rick for this very practical advice, and reminder that Big Dreams don’t happen overnight but require incremental progress over a long period of time!&amp;amp;nbsp; &amp;amp;nbsp; For our show notes, visit DreamBigPodcast.com/254 </description>
